Alex Hales called into England one-day international squad


The 25-year-old batsman starred in Tuesday’s Twenty20 match against the same opponents, hitting 66 off 41 deliveries.

He was not included in Thursday’s first one-day international, though, despite his performance earlier in the week.

But Hales’ time may have come after captain Alastair Cook felt tightness in his groin ahead of Sunday’s clash in Durham.

An England and Wales Cricket Board statement said on Saturday: “Alex Hales has been added to the England ODI squad for the second Royal London One-Day International against Sri Lanka as cover for Alastair Cook who has right groin tightness.

“Cook will be assessed ahead of the game.”
Hales has never represented England in the 50-over format, but has played 32 Twenty20 internationals, averaging 37.85 with the bat.

He made England’s only ever Twenty20 international century against Sri Lanka in the ICC World Twenty20 in March, smashing 116 not out to guide his side to a group stage win.

England lead the five-match one-day series 1-0.
